Pre-resection Intraoperative Core Biopsies in Oral Tongue Cancer-A Pilot Study

OBJECTIVE: To assess a novel intraoperative core biopsy technique to provide enhanced guidance in partial glossectomies.
METHODS: All patients diagnosed with squamous cell carcinoma of the oral tongue were eligible for study participation. Following anesthesia, the planned resection and three points midway between the gross tumor and the intended ablation were marked. A core biopsy was performed with a needle spring on each point and sent for frozen sections. The initially planned resection was executed if the cores returned free of tumor. In case of a positive core biopsy, a new 1-1.5 cm margin was marked around that point. The main outcome measure was the closest final margin diameter, especially the deep ones. Other outcome measures were the core biopsies' sensitivity, specificity, and negative predictive value. Complications were recorded.
RESULTS: The final margins of 10 patients undergoing intraoperative core biopsies and 20 matched controls were analyzed. One patient had two positive cores and final negative margins after modifying the resection accordingly. Another patient had a positive biopsy diagnosed only on final pathology, and one close final margin. Patients that were operated with the new technique had larger margins compared to the controls: median (interquartile range) closest margin 5.95 (3.97; 9.63) mm versus 4 (2.25; 5) mm (p = 0.074) and median deep margin 8.6 (6.16; 10) mm versus 5 (3;10) mm (p = 0.411), respectively. There were no complications.
CONCLUSION: A novel pre-resection intraoperative biopsy technique is presented. Core biopsies taken during glossectomies have the potential to prevent inadequate margins.
